Non Slicing Floorplan Representations in VLSI Floorplanning: A Summary
Floorplan representation is a fundamental issue in designing a VLSI floorplanning algorithm as the representation has a great impact on the feasibility and complexity of floorplan designs. This survey paper gives an up-to-date account on various nonslicing floorplan representations in VLSI floorplanning.

متن کاملSlicing floorplan with clustering constraint
In floorplan design it is useful to allow users to specify some placement constraints in the final packing. Clustering constraint is a popular type of placement constraint in which a given set of modules are restricted to be placed adjacent to one another.
